Strategies for Navigating the Crash Landscape
While crash games are largely based on chance, certain strategies can help players manage their risk and potentially improve their chances of winning. One popular technique is ‘auto-cash out,’ allowing players to set a specific multiplier at which their bet will automatically be cashed out, removing the emotional pressure of manually timing the exit. Another approach involves using a ‘martingale’ system, where the bet amount is doubled after each loss, with the intention of recouping previous losses and securing a small profit. However, the martingale system can be extremely risky, as it requires a substantial bankroll and can lead to significant losses if a losing streak persists. Diverse strategies are used by players, ranging from statistically driven analysis of past game outcomes to intuition-based approaches.
The Importance of Bankroll Management
Effective bankroll management is arguably the most crucial aspect of playing crash games successfully. This involves setting aside a specific amount of money solely for gambling, and never exceeding that limit. Divide your bankroll into smaller units, and only bet a small percentage of your total bankroll on each round. A common guideline is to risk no more than 1-2% of your bankroll per bet. This helps to cushion against losing streaks and prevents you from quickly depleting your funds. Regularly review your bankroll and adjust your betting strategy accordingly. Treat any winnings as a bonus, and resist the temptation to reinvest them all back into the game.

How Provably Fair Technology Works
The core of a provably fair system lies in the unpredictability of the cryptographic hash function. A hash function takes an input (in this case, the server seed, client seed, and nonce) and produces a unique, fixed-size output. The output is deterministic, meaning that the same input will always produce the same output. However, it is computationally infeasible to reverse the process – to determine the input given only the output. This ensures that the server cannot manipulate the outcome of the game after the seeds have been generated. Players can verify the fairness of the game by examining the seeds and nonce, and independently recalculating the hash to confirm that the stated outcome is mathematically consistent. This transparency is a crucial element in building trust and ensuring a fair gaming experience.
- The server generates a random server seed.
- The client generates a random client seed.
- A nonce is incremented with each round.
- The seeds and nonce are combined and hashed.
- The hash determines the crash point.
- Players can verify the fairness using the seeds and nonce.
This process, while technically complex, allows for a verifiable and tamper-proof gaming experience. Players who are unfamiliar with cryptography can often find detailed explanations and verification tools on the platform’s website.
